Understanding Carbon Fiber Panel Technology

Composition and Manufacturing Process

Carbon fiber panels are created through an intricate process that begins with thin strands of carbon atoms bonded together in a crystalline formation. These fibers, thinner than human hair, are woven into sheets and combined with high-performance resins to create composite panels. The manufacturing process involves carefully controlling temperature and pressure to ensure optimal fiber alignment and resin distribution, resulting in panels with exceptional structural properties.

The quality of carbon fiber panels depends significantly on the fiber-to-resin ratio, fiber orientation, and curing conditions. Advanced manufacturing techniques allow for precise control over these parameters, ensuring consistent performance across large panel sections. This level of manufacturing precision is crucial for construction applications where structural integrity cannot be compromised.

Material Properties and Advantages

The remarkable properties of carbon fiber panels make them ideal for construction applications. Their high tensile strength surpasses that of steel while weighing significantly less. This exceptional strength-to-weight ratio allows for larger spans and more efficient structural designs. Additionally, carbon fiber panels exhibit excellent fatigue resistance and minimal thermal expansion, ensuring long-term structural stability under varying environmental conditions.

These panels also demonstrate superior corrosion resistance compared to traditional materials, significantly reducing maintenance requirements and extending the structure's lifespan. Their dimensional stability and resistance to environmental factors make them particularly valuable in challenging construction environments.

Applications in Modern Construction

Structural Reinforcement Solutions

Carbon fiber panels excel in strengthening existing structures, offering a non-invasive method for increasing load-bearing capacity. When applied to beams, columns, or walls, these panels can significantly enhance structural performance without substantially increasing the dead load. This makes them particularly valuable in renovation projects where adding traditional reinforcement methods might be impractical or impossible.

The versatility of carbon fiber panels allows for various installation methods, including external bonding and near-surface mounting. These techniques can be customized to address specific structural requirements while minimizing disruption to the existing structure. The ability to apply reinforcement precisely where needed makes carbon fiber panels an efficient and cost-effective solution for structural enhancement.

Implementation and Installation Considerations

Technical Requirements and Standards

Successful implementation of carbon fiber panels requires careful attention to technical specifications and installation procedures. Proper surface preparation, adhesive selection, and application techniques are crucial for achieving optimal structural performance. Industry standards and building codes provide guidelines for the design and installation of carbon fiber reinforcement systems, ensuring safety and reliability.

Quality control during installation is essential, with particular focus on proper fiber orientation, resin saturation, and cure conditions. Environmental factors such as temperature and humidity must be carefully monitored during installation to ensure proper bonding and long-term performance.

Cost Analysis and Long-term Benefits

While the initial cost of carbon fiber panels may be higher than traditional materials, their long-term benefits often justify the investment. Reduced maintenance requirements, extended service life, and improved structural performance contribute to favorable lifecycle costs. The lightweight nature of these panels also reduces installation time and labor costs, potentially offsetting higher material expenses.

Additionally, the durability and resistance to environmental degradation of carbon fiber panels can significantly reduce long-term maintenance and replacement costs. This durability, combined with their structural efficiency, makes them an economically viable choice for many construction projects.

Sustainability and Environmental Impact

The construction industry's growing focus on sustainability has sparked interest in the environmental aspects of carbon fiber panels. While their production currently has a significant carbon footprint, ongoing research aims to develop more sustainable manufacturing processes and recycling methods. The extended lifespan and reduced maintenance requirements of carbon fiber panels contribute positively to their overall environmental impact.

Future developments may include bio-based carbon fibers and more energy-efficient production methods, aligning with global sustainability goals. The potential for reducing material waste and improving building energy efficiency through the use of carbon fiber panels continues to drive innovation in this field.
